Former Head of the Ministry of Defense Procurement Department: I admit the circumstances that I caused damage to the state budget and I regret it - the minister was informed about all major procurements

I admit the circumstances that through the mentioned actions I caused damage to the state budget and I regret it, but I would like to say that the employees under my subordination were carrying out my assignments, - stated Vladimir Ghudushauri, the former head of the Ministry of Defense Procurement Department, who was detained on charges of squandering a large amount of funds belonging to the Ministry of Defense of Georgia.

Vladimir Ghudushauri was presented by the prosecution as a witness at the court hearing.

According to him, he had no experience in purchasing medical equipment, which is why he could not realize that the amounts named by the companies were higher compared to the existing market prices.

"The minister [Juansher Burchuladze] contacted me and told me that we needed to procure the necessary medical equipment through a secret procurement. He also asked if I knew Zurab Tukvadze and told me that I should do everything according to his instructions. I informed Giorgi Khaidraya about the matter, and he told me to follow the minister's instructions. I contacted Zurab Tukvadze and invited him to my office. When I spoke to him, I realized that he had been expecting my call. When we met, we did not have any substantive conversation. He gave me the details of two companies and told me to conduct market research with these companies. After that, a list of equipment to be purchased came from Gori Hospital addressed to the minister, but the equipment was not accompanied by specifications, and I requested that technical specifications also be provided. Later, part of the technical specifications for the equipment was sent to me personally, after which I instructed Irakli Mgaloblishvili to start the procurements, conduct market research, and I gave him the details of the two companies. None of my employees knew about my meeting with the minister. A price survey was conducted, in which only one company participated. Then the tender commission was convened and approved this company as the winner, after which the contract was signed. I did not verify this company because it was the minister's order.

After the first contract, Gori Hospital submitted the specifications for the remaining medical equipment. At that time, Zurab Tukvadze gave me the details of one more company. Accordingly, this company participated in the subsequent procurements. Since the list was extensive, three companies were declared winners.

I had no experience in procuring medical equipment, I could not realize that the prices they quoted exceeded the market prices, but since the order came from the minister, I no longer asked questions. Otherwise, we would have investigated all companies and acted in such a way as to obtain the lowest price.

I admit the circumstances that through the mentioned actions I caused damage to the state budget and I regret it, but I would like to say that the employees under my subordination were carrying out my assignments.

The minister was informed about all major procurements.

Since in the Ministry of Defense the commission was not convened and this was a harmful practice, it was impossible for critical opinions to be recorded.

As for large procurements, in most cases they were pre-agreed and decided by the minister.

I believe that there are other companies on the market that can produce similar medical equipment," - stated Vladimir Ghudushauri.

For information: Former Defense Minister Juansher Burchuladze has been charged under Article 194(3)(c) and Article 332(2) of the Criminal Code of Georgia, which involve abuse of official authority and legalization of illegal income. The mentioned act provides for imprisonment from 9 to 12 years as punishment.

Burchuladze is accused in total of legalizing 1,593,212 GEL of illegal and unsubstantiated income. According to the charges, in 2023 Juansher Burchuladze, with the assistance of his deputy, a relative, and the former head of the Ministry of Defense Procurement Department, supplied medical equipment to the military hospital for 3,940,000 GEL instead of 2,606,272 GEL, resulting in property damage of 1,333,728 GEL to the ministry. In addition, in March 2025, Juansher Burchuladze and his wife purchased property in Spain for 544,000 euros. In order to conceal and disguise the origin of this property and give it a legal appearance, they concluded a fictitious sale-purchase agreement for real estate located in Daba Tskneti with a third party.

As for Vladimir Ghudushauri and Giorgi Khaidraya, they are accused of squandering a large amount of funds, while Vasil Mkheidze is accused of assisting in the squandering. They have been charged under Article 182(2)(a), (d) and (3)(b) of the Criminal Code of Georgia for squandering and assisting in squandering a large amount of funds belonging to the Ministry of Defense of Georgia by a group through prior agreement and using official position, which provides for imprisonment from 7 to 11 years.

Vladimir Ghudushauri has been released on bail.
